> excessive access to hydro power.

Not at current levels of consumption and production.

We are about 98% hydro now and it's probably going down as more people use more energy.

But you are still correct, Norway is the ideal country to try this and it is an explicit aim of the government now to have all short haul flights electric by 2050. We already have electric ferries on the fjords, electric buses, and, of course, a lot of electric cars (more than 100 thousand electric cars in Norway now).

It would make infinitely more sense to look into carbon neutral hydrocarbon fuels that could be used in conventional turbofans. Some more material on this topic: https://aviation.stackexchange.com/questions/26910/could-an-...

Another SE link of interest, how much electrical power needed to run a 747 engine: https://aviation.stackexchange.com/questions/19569/how-many-... The consensus is ~90 MW. That's a lot of energy, electric air travel is certainly possible, but it will likely come at a severe cost to speed and endurance. If we are going to travel slowly would personally prefer autonomous airships.

When I last looked into this, I googled electric motors in the +30MW range and found that some gas pipelines use electric turbines of that power. These are massive, stationary engines which made me wonder if the weight of the motors might be an equally serious problem as the weight of the energy storage. Carbon neutral jet fuel really seems to be the simpler alternative.

Megawatts is a power unit. To sustain 90MW for a 4hr flight you need a battery that can provide 360MWh of energy. Anyone care to do the numbers on how much a lithium ion battery would weigh to be able to deliver 360MWh, and remember if you want to use it more than once you can full charge no discharge it.

A standard lithium ion battery has between 100-265 Wh/kg if you need 360 thousand to 135 thousand kg of lithium ion batteries plus probably a few thousand for charging equipment. A a 747 has capacity for about 45k kg of fuel so a factor of 4 improvement is needed before that is comparable.

The energy density of most fossil fuels is still far beyond anything we've managed through incremental improvement on 1900's battery technology.

There's much more work to be done.

Wouldn't a country with vast access to hydro power be inclined to not invest in wind? And why cherry pick wind power anyway?

It is not cost-effective to build much wind power in Norway, because of excessive cheap hydro power. Statoil and Statkraft build them in UK, where the price and subsidies are more favourable.
